Launched in 2009, Blue Line Sterilization Services has been concentrated to reducing the time to market for innovators designing new medical devices. The company excels by maintaining a bank of 8 cubic foot ethylene oxide (EO) sterilizers, providing FDA and EU compliant sterilization with turnaround times ranging from 1 to 3 days—an achievement impractical with larger EO sterilization services.
Co-founders Brant and Jane Gard realized the significant need for accelerated sterilization options, particularly for rapid development programs engineering innovative medical devices. The ability to swiftly navigate through device iterations is fundamental in reducing the need for additional funding, preserving the value of investors' equity, and expediting time to market. Faster service and reduced time to market hold immense value for employees, investors, and the patients benefiting from improved medical care.
Complementing routine sterilization, Blue Line offers rapid turnkey validations and small batch releases that support clinical trials and FDA/CE submissions. Why Sterilization of Medical Instruments is Critical
Preventing infections remains a core component of modern medicine.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) estimate that around 1 in 31 hospital patients experiences at least one healthcare-associated infection (HAI). Correct sterilization of medical devices markedly reduces the risk of these infections, safeguarding patients and healthcare providers simultaneously. Deficient sterilization can trigger outbreaks of dangerous diseases like hepatitis, HIV, and antibiotic-resistant bacterial infections.
Medical Device Sterilization Methods
The science behind sterilization has transformed remarkably over the last century, utilizing a variety of methods suited to distinct types of devices and materials. Some of the most popularly adopted techniques include:
Steam-Based Sterilization (Autoclaving)
Autoclaving remains the most frequent and trusted method of sterilization, particularly suitable for surgical instruments and reusable metal devices. Using high-pressure saturated steam at temperatures around 121–134°C, autoclaving effectively kills bacteria, viruses, fungi, and spores. This method is fast, cost-efficient, and ecologically sound, although not suitable for heat-sensitive materials.

Sophisticated Materials and Device Complexity
The increase of advanced medical devices—such as robotic surgery instruments and intricate diagnostic equipment—demands sterilization systems capable of handling intricate materials. Evolution in sterilization include methods such as low-temperature plasma sterilization and hydrogen peroxide vapor, which can sterilize without damaging vulnerable components.
Automated Sterilization Tracking
With advances in digital technology, documentation of sterilization operations is now more precise than ever. Digital traceability systems offer exhaustive documentation, automated compliance checks, and real-time alerts, significantly reducing human error and improving patient safety.
